Recognizing these broader considerations helps avoid common pitfalls like overpaying for unnecessary features or selecting a machine that won’t meet your specific needs.Build Quality and Frame Rigidity
For precise carving, a sturdy frame made of metal such as aluminum or steel is essential. Flexing or vibrations during operation can ruin fine details, so look for machines with reinforced structures and linear guides. Cheaper models with plastic parts or loose fittings tend to compromise accuracy, especially when working with harder materials. Investing in a robust frame results in cleaner cuts and more reliable repeatability, which is fundamental for detailed work.
Spindle Power and Speed
The spindle determines how well the machine can handle different materials and achieve fine detail. Higher wattage spindles (at least 300W) provide more consistent performance on metals and dense woods, but they can be more expensive and generate more heat. Variable speed control allows for fine adjustments, crucial for detailed engraving. Choosing the right spindle balances power and control, ensuring precise carving without burning or deflecting the tool.
Control System and Software Compatibility
Accurate carving depends on precise control signals. Look for a CNC router with a reliable control system like GRBL or Mach3, which support detailed micro-movements. Compatibility with user-friendly CAD/CAM software also simplifies programming intricate designs. More advanced control options may offer better repeatability but require a steeper learning curve. For beginners, an intuitive interface can save time and frustration, while experienced users may prefer customizable firmware for maximum precision.
Size, Workspace, and Material Handling
The size of the work area should match your typical project dimensions. Larger zones offer versatility but can increase machine footprint and cost. Additionally, consider the machine’s ability to handle various materials—some models excel with soft woods, plastics, and acrylics, but struggle with metals. Choosing a size that suits your typical projects and material preferences helps maximize efficiency and precision. Remember, bigger isn’t always better if it exceeds your workspace or budget.
Ease of Use and Maintenance
A well-designed CNC router should not only produce precise results but also be straightforward to operate and maintain. Features like easy tool changes, accessible wiring, and clear calibration procedures reduce downtime and errors. Regular maintenance of linear guides, belts, and spindles preserves accuracy over time. Avoid overly complicated setups if you prefer a more plug-and-play experience, but don’t compromise on the quality needed for detailed carving—sometimes, investing in a slightly more complex machine pays off in precision.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can a cheaper CNC router produce detailed carvings?
Lower-priced CNC routers can handle basic detailed work, especially on soft materials like wood or plastic. However, they often lack the rigidity, spindle power, and control precision needed for fine, intricate carving on harder materials such as metals or dense woods. These machines may produce inconsistent results or require more manual adjustments. If your projects demand high accuracy and detailed features, investing in a more robust, precise model tends to yield better long-term results.
What is the most important feature for achieving precision in a CNC router?
The key factor is the machine’s frame rigidity combined with high-quality linear guides and a stable spindle. These elements minimize vibrations and deflections during operation, which directly affects the detail and accuracy of carvings. Even the most sophisticated control systems can’t fully compensate for a loose or flexible frame. Prioritizing a solid build ensures the machine can consistently produce precise, repeatable results.
Is a larger work area better for precise carving?
A larger workspace offers more flexibility for bigger projects, but it doesn’t necessarily improve precision. In fact, bigger machines can be more challenging to maintain rigidity, which might reduce accuracy if not well-designed. For most detailed work, a properly sized, well-constructed machine that fits your typical project dimensions is preferable. Overextending the size can lead to increased costs and complexity without meaningful gains in carving detail.
Should I prioritize spindle power or control software for accuracy?
Both are important, but control software and system accuracy often have a more immediate impact on precision. Good software ensures detailed toolpath execution with minimal error, while a powerful spindle allows for more consistent cutting, especially on tougher materials. Ideally, choose a machine with a balanced combination of both features—powerful enough to handle your materials and precise control to execute intricate designs reliably.
How much maintenance is needed to keep a CNC router precise?
Maintaining precision requires regular checks and servicing of linear guides, belts, and spindle components. Cleaning debris, lubricating moving parts, and tightening loose fittings help preserve accuracy. Over time, wear can affect the machine’s performance, so scheduled maintenance routines are essential. Investing in a machine with accessible components makes upkeep easier and helps sustain carving quality over years of use.
